Breaking Down Personal Injury Lawyer Cases

A personal injury lawyer is a legal professional who handles claims on behalf of individuals who suffered harm due to someone else's carelessness. The scope of this work is broad and varied, covering everything from investigating accidents to filing insurance claims.

Personal injury matters usually start with an investigation phase where your attorney collects supporting materials. From there, our team will determine who is at fault, estimate the full value of your losses, and engage with the at-fault party's insurer. If a reasonable agreement cannot be negotiated, your lawyer will not hesitate to take your case to court.

Who needs a personal injury lawyer? Anyone who has suffered bodily harm triggered by another person's or entity's negligence may have a valid claim. This encompasses car accident victims, slip and fall victims, employees injured at work, and many others.

Common Questions About Personal Injury Lawyer Representation

Here are responses to some of the most common questions people have about hiring legal representation:

Is hiring a personal injury attorney expensive?

Personal injury firms like ours accept cases without upfront payment, meaning there is no fee unless your case results in compensation. Typical rates range from 25% to 40%. This structure ensures that skilled attorneys is accessible regardless of income.

How long does a personal injury case take to resolve?

The timeline varies considerably on the complexity of the facts. Minor injury matters may settle in a few months, while complex or disputed cases can take one to three years. Our attorneys work efficiently without sacrificing value.

What am I entitled to after an injury caused by someone else?

Injury cases can recover several categories of damages. Economic damages include medical expenses, anticipated care needs, reduced earning capacity, and vehicle repair costs. Compensation also extends to diminished quality of life. When the defendant's conduct was, additional financial penalties may also be available.

Should I settle my injury claim or take it to court?

A settlement involves the at-fault party or insurer agreeing to avoid court by offering end the dispute. Litigating means the court rules on damages and liability. Agreements outside court close cases more quickly and carry less risk, but litigation sometimes produces better results if the insurer has been unreasonable.

What are the most important steps to take following an injury caused by negligence?

Your actions in the immediate period following an accident can significantly affect your case. First, seek medical attention as soon as possible — many conditions present symptoms days later. Capture evidence whenever safe to do so. Refuse to offer formal comments to the other party's insurer before consulting legal counsel. Contact a personal injury lawyer as soon as possible.
